John Krasinski has clarified the reasons he sold his fledging feel-good web series SomeGoodNews to CBS

was never meant to be a long term thing especially with all his other acting, writing and directing commitments. "I was only planning on doing [eight episodes] during quarantine. I have these other things that I’m going to be having to do very soon, likeHe added: "More than that, writing, directing and producing — all those things — with a couple of my friends was so much, and I knew it wouldn’t be sustainable with my prior commitments.

"I knew the two options were always going to be, I leave it off at eight in my office, which I would love to keep doing this show from my office forever, but it just wasn’t sustainable," Krasinski explained to Wilson. "I knew I would need a partner coming on." Krasinski told Wilson that it was "insane" having "one of the biggest news programs in America, CBS News, saying they want to make it part of their permanent news cycle." He added that he had "a lot of really fun stuff planned" for the series and will be involved as much as he can be. while stuck at home during the pandemic lockdowns.
